(AbluelawisonerestrictingactivitiesorsalesofgoodsonSunday,toaccommodatetheChristiansabbath.ThefirstbluelawintheAmericancolonieswasenactedinVirginiain1617.Itrequiredchurchattendanceandauthorizedthemilitiatoforcecoloniststoattendchurchservices・

Otherearlybluelawsprohibitedwork,travel,recreation,andactivitiessuchascooking,shaving,cuttinghair,wearingeitherlaceorpreciousmetals,sweeping,makingbeds,kissing,andengaginginsexualintercourse・ThePuritansbelievedthatachildwasbomonthesamedayoftheweekonwhichitwasconceived・Therefore,theparentsofchildrenbornonaSundaywerepunishedforviolatingthebluelawninemonthsearlier.

AlthoughbluelawsrequiringSundaychurchattendsneedisappearedinthenineteenthcenturybecausetheyviolatedcitizen'rightstoreligiousfreedoms,otherbluelawshavecontinuedtoexistintothemodernera.InTexas,forexample,bluelawsprohibitedsellinghousewaressuchaspots,pans,andwashingmachinesonSundayuntil1985,andcardealershipsinthestatecontinuetooperateunderblue-lawprohibitions.ManystatesstillprohibitsellingalcoholonSunday,althoughit'snowthesecondbusiestshoppingdayoftheweek.)
